ollanta humala nadine heredia
By Colin Post
September 21, 2015
You Might Also Enjoy
Las Bambas: four villages threaten to paralyze Peru’s largest copper mine
By Colin Post - October 24, 2016
Peru completes joint emergency exercise with the United States
By Michael Krumholtz - November 25, 2018
How Peruvian President Pedro Castillo navigated his most recent impeachment attempt in Congress
By Shirley Cayetano - March 31, 2022